Overview
Azure Repos
Azure Repos gives you a professional environment to manage your code using either Git or Team Foundation Version Control. You can host unlimited private repositories in the cloud, allowing your team to collaborate securely on projects of any size. It simplifies your development workflow by providing integrated pull requests and advanced file searching, so you always find what you need quickly.
You can connect to your code from any IDE, editor, or CLI, ensuring your existing workflow remains uninterrupted. The platform handles everything from small hobby projects to massive enterprise codebases with ease. By integrating directly with the broader Azure DevOps ecosystem, you can link your code changes to specific tasks and automate your build-to-deployment pipeline without switching between multiple disconnected tools.
Perforce Helix Core
Perforce Helix Core is the version control backbone for teams building complex products like video games, automotive software, and semiconductors. You can manage massive datasets and thousands of users without sacrificing performance, as it handles millions of daily transactions and petabytes of data. It serves as a single source of truth for your entire project, keeping code and large binary files in one secure location.
You can collaborate globally with high-speed file transfers and automated workflows that sync across remote sites. Whether you are a small indie studio or a global enterprise, it provides the granular permissions and audit trails you need for security. It integrates with the tools you already use, like Visual Studio and Unreal Engine, to keep your development pipeline moving fast.

Azure Repos Features
- Unlimited Private Git Hosting Create as many private Git repositories as you need for your projects without worrying about increasing storage costs.
- Collaborative Pull Requests Review code with your team, leave threaded comments, and ensure only high-quality changes are merged into your main branch.
- Advanced File Search Find specific code snippets or files across your entire project quickly with powerful, semantic-aware search capabilities.
- Branch Policies Maintain strict code standards by requiring successful builds or specific numbers of reviewers before code can be merged.
- Web Hooks and Extensions Trigger external services or add custom functionality to your workflow using a wide range of marketplace extensions.
- Integrated Work Items Link your commits and pull requests directly to Azure Boards tasks to maintain full traceability of every change.
Perforce Helix Core Features
- Centralized Versioning. Store all your source code and large binary assets in one place to maintain a single source of truth.
- High-Performance Scaling. Support thousands of concurrent users and millions of files without experiencing the performance lag common in other systems.
- Granular Permissions. Control access down to the individual file level to protect your intellectual property and ensure project security.
- Helix Visual Client. Manage your files and version history through an intuitive graphical interface that simplifies complex branching and merging tasks.
- Global Replication. Deliver files to remote teams faster by using edge servers that reduce latency and local network traffic.
- Game Engine Integration. Connect directly with Unreal Engine and Unity so your artists and designers can version assets without leaving their tools.
